顶空气相色谱法测定艾曲波帕原料药中残留溶剂
Determination of residual solvents in Eltrombopag Olamine active pharmaceutical ingredients by headspace gas chromatography
目的 建立同时测定艾曲波帕原料药中8种有机溶剂(甲醇、乙醇、二氯甲烷、乙酸乙酯、四氢呋喃、三乙胺、正庚烷和吡啶)残留量的顶空气相色谱法。 方法 色谱柱为DB-1毛细管色谱柱(30 m×0.53 mm×2.65 μm),程序升温,进样口温度为250 ℃,检测器为火焰离子化检测器,温度为250 ℃,载气为高纯氮气,流速为2.5 mL/min,分流比为10∶1,顶空瓶平衡温度为90 ℃,平衡时间为25 min。对建立的方法进行专属性、线性和范围、检测限和定量限、精密度、重复性、加样回收率、稳定性考察。 结果 艾曲波帕原料药中8种残留溶剂(甲醇、乙醇、二氯甲烷、乙酸乙酯、四氢呋喃、三乙胺、正庚烷和吡啶)在一定浓度范围内显示良好的线性(r>0.999),定量限分别为6.0,7.6,6.2,4.0,1.5,0.76,0.75,3.9 μg/mL;检测限分别为2.0,2.5,2.1,1.3,0.5,0.25,0.25,1.3 μg/mL;平均回收率分别为102.4%,101.7%,101.6%,100.6%,101.4%,98.2%,100.7%和99.9%;RSD值分别为1.9%,1.7%,1.9%,1.7%,2.1%,1.9%,1.5%和1.5%(n=9);专属性、精密度、重复性、稳定性均符合方法学验证要求。 结论 本研究所建立的顶空气相色谱法适用于艾曲波帕原料药中8种残留溶剂的测定。
Objective To establish a headspace gas chromatographic method for the simultaneous determination of eight residual organic solvents(methanol, ethanol,dichloromethane, ethyl acetate, tetrahydrofuran, triethylamine, heptane and pyridine) in Eltrombopag Olamine active pharmaceutical ingredients(API). Methods The chromatographic column was DB-1 capillary column (30 m×0.53 mm×2.65 μm) with temperature-programmed, the temperature of the injection port was 250 ℃, the detector was flame ionization detector(FID) with the temperature of 250 ℃, the carrier gas was high purity nitrogen gas with the flow rate of 2.5 mL/min, the split ratio was 10∶1, the headspace heating temperature was 90 ℃, and the equilibrium time was 25 min. Specificity, linearity and range, detection limit and quantification limit, precision, repeatability, recovery, stability of the method were validated. Results Each of the eight residual solvents (methanol, ethanol, dichloromethane, ethyl acetate, tetrahydrofuran, triethylamine, heptane and pyridine) had good linearity within a certain concentration range(r>0.999), the limits of quantitation(LOQ) were 6.0, 7.6, 6.2, 4.0, 1.5, 0.76, 0.75, 3.9 μg/mL, and the limits of detection(LOD) were 2.0, 2.5, 2.1, 1.3, 0.5, 0.25, 0.25, 1.3 μg/mL. The average recoveries were 102.4%, 101.7%, 101.6%, 100.6%, 101.4%, 98.2%, 100.7% and 99.9%, and the RSD values were 1.9%, 1.7%, 1.9%, 1.7%, 2.1%, 1.9%, 1.5% and 1.5%(n=9), respectively. The specificity, precision, repeatability, and stability met the requirements of method validation. Conclusion The established headspace gas chromatographic method is suitable for the simultaneous determination of eight residual solvents in eltrombopag olamine API.
